Identification of prohibitin as an antigen in Behcet's disease

Biochem Biophys Res Commun. 2014 Aug 29;451(3):389-93. doi: 10.1016/j.bbrc.2014.07.126. Epub 2014 Aug 1.

Abstract

Objective: This study is intended to screen potential antigen for Behcet's disease (BD) by using human microvascular endothelial cells (HUVEC).

Methods: Following cell-based indirect immunofluorescence assay with sera from BD patients, proteins extracted from HUVEC were separated and detected by Western blotting. Then the target protein was identified by LC-MALDI-TOF/TOF, the recombinant target protein was expressed, purified and then used as coating antigen to test the prevalence of autoantibodies in patient's sera.

Results: The Western blotting result showed that some patients' sera could react with a protein band with about 30 kDa of molecular weight, which was further identified as prohibitin by mass spectrometry. The prevalence of serum antibodies against recombinant human prohibitin was detected in 16 of 58 BD patients (28%) but none in healthy controls.
